What is A Body Hair Transplant?

A body hair transplant (BHT) is a form of hair restoration which involves the removal of hair from areas of the body that are non-scalp, such as the chest, arms, back and beard, and then relocating them to the scalp. This technique proves to be beneficial to individuals who suffer from advanced baldness and do not have sufficient donor hair located on their scalp.

How Does A Body Hair Transplant Work?

The FUE, or Follicular Unit Extraction method, is employed to remove hair from non-scalp areas on the body. The hair follicles that have been removed are then moved to the designated area on the scalp. The remaining hairs on the scalp will begin merging with the hair follicles over a designated period.

Reasons for opting for body hair transplant procedures:

Body hair transplant to head turkey procedure is very suitable for patients who have depleted their scalp donor supply. Below are some pointers:

1. Increased Donor Supply: People with limited scalp donor hair are still able to achieve maximum coverage by utilizing body hair. Chest and beard hair are familiar sources as they have a similar texture to scalp hair.

2. Suited for Repair Cases: In case a person has had previous failed transplants, a hair transplant using body hair can help to reverse the effects. It can help in scar revision from earlier procedures.

3. Effective with Advanced Hair Loss: Patients with Norwood 6 or 7 baldness (advanced stages of hair loss) usually do not have sufficient scalp donor hair. Body hair transplant to head turkey procedures can help these patients achieve adequate coverage.

The Process of Hair Transplants from the Body

Step 1: Consultation & Evaluation

During the initial consultation, a body hair transplant clinic will review the potential donor sites.

The surgeon will assess how many grafts are needed and which specific areas will be used.

Step 2: Donor Hair Extraction

Individual follicles are removed with the use of a fine needle, which is known as the FUE technique.

The patient’s chest and beard area, as well as their back, is usually used for donor sites.

Step 3: Follicle Implantation

The follicles are then implanted into the scalp at a preset position by using any precision implanting device.

Each implanted follicle is placed in the vicinity of natural follicles so that it can mimic the hair growth direction.

Step 4: Healing & Recovery

The estimate for recovery is about ten to fourteen days.

Shedding of the hair and then, within a three to six-month period, new hair covering the scalp growing is expected.

Hair Transplant Using Body Hair: Considerations

1. Differences in Texture
Body hair can be curlier and coarser than scalp hair.   
The surgeon needs to blend it well to allow the natural look to shine.   

2. Growth Cycle Differences
Body hair has a different growth cycle, meaning the rate may differ significantly from that of scalp hair.    

3. Need of Grafts
Because body hair is usually coarser, it is possible to achieve coverage with fewer grafts than usual.  

4. Time in Recovery
It is possible that healing takes slightly longer for areas of the body where the hair was harvested.

Cost For Body Hair Transplant Procedures

The cost of the body hair transplant to head turkey procedure is dependent on: The amount of grafts required. The level of difficulty of the procedure. The physician’s skill. The reputation and status of the clinic. In Turkey, the cost for a body hair transplant ranges from $2000 to $7000, averaging much lower than that of the United States and Britain.
